Automotive Technician Jobs in Missouri

An Automotive Technician, also known as a mechanic, is an integral part of the automotive industry. They are responsible for diagnosing, repairing, and maintaining a wide range of vehicles. Their duties include performing oil changes, inspecting vehicles for mechanical defects, repairing or replacing worn parts, and ensuring vehicles are running efficiently. They often work with sophisticated diagnostic equipment to identify issues and use a variety of tools to perform their tasks. Automotive Technicians must also stay updated on the latest advances in automotive technology and participate in ongoing education and training.

Important skills for an Automotive Technician include problem-solving, attention to detail, and excellent hand-eye coordination. They should also be familiar with various types of computer software used to diagnose vehicle problems. Certifications from the National Institute for Automotive Service Excellence (ASE) are highly desirable. Possible job roles before becoming an Automotive Technician could include a tire technician, oil change technician, or automotive service associate where one gains hands-on experience working with vehicles. A solid foundation in mechanical knowledge, either through vocational training or an associate degree in automotive technology, is typically required to advance to the role of an Automotive Technician.
